Local Breakdown Patterns

Common Fleet Preventive Maintenance Issues in San Tan Valley

Patterns observed across recent dispatch data in this metro, by service type and corridor.

110F-plus desert tire blowouts on Hunt Highway

Pinal County summers blow past 110F, and a loaded building-materials truck running the long open Hunt Highway stretches cooks its tires until they let go. Blowout calls peak June through August. Every San Tan Valley service truck carries the common steer and drive sizes so a hauler can get back to a new subdivision job without a tow back into Phoenix.

Monsoon haboob zero-visibility shutdowns

When the summer monsoon fires up, a haboob, a towering wall of blowing dust, can roll across the open desert and drop visibility to zero on US-60 or AZ-24 in minutes, forcing trucks to stop where they sit. Clogged air filters, sand-packed radiators, and chain-reaction collisions follow. Our dispatchers track the dust and storm cells and stage units to reach stopped trucks the moment the wall passes.

Desert-heat cooling failure on remote AZ-79 runs

Aggregate and copper haulers on AZ-79 toward Florence and the mining country run remote desert miles where a cooling failure leaves a truck a long way from any shop. The exposed pavement and 110F-plus heat boil over any marginal radiator. Our mechanics stock coolant and hose kits for self-sufficient roadside repair on these remote Pinal County runs.

City Profile

San Tan Valley AZ Trucking & Freight Industry Overview

San Tan Valley sits on the fast-growing southeast edge of metro Phoenix in Pinal County, where Hunt Highway, Ironwood, and the AZ-24 Gateway Freeway feed last-mile and construction freight into one of the country's most explosive housing markets. US-60 ties the area into the Phoenix freight grid and the I-10 corridor beyond. It is a booming exurban distribution and building-materials submarket on the desert's edge.

San Tan Valley is a town in northern Pinal County, Arizona, United States. The population was 99,894 at the 2020 census. Proposition 495, a measure to incorporate San Tan Valley as a municipality, passed in 2025. It is one of the most recently incorporated cities in the country.

San Tan Valley sprawls across the southeast desert edge of metro Phoenix, where Hunt Highway and the new AZ-24 Gateway Freeway pour construction and last-mile freight into one of the fastest-growing housing markets in America. Building-materials haulers, concrete trucks, and delivery fleets work the Pinal County desert grid hard, and the open runs toward US-60 leave little margin in the summer heat. Do you handle DPF and after-treatment work roadside?

Most DPF regen issues we resolve roadside with a forced regen and a cleaning of the differential pressure sensor. Desert dust loads the system fast, so our techs watch for it. Full DPF removal and cleaning happens at our partner shops.
